iamthenublack: Kojo Owusu-Kusi of Citizins

Introduce yourself

My name is Kojo Owusu-Kusi. I’m currently a lover, fighter, student and father. I’m a brother, an undergrad, sneaker freak and truth seeker. Just a normal Joe or where I’m from a normal “Kojo”. I also run T-Shirt company Citizins which I began after high school, in the summer of 2003 with some friends as a joke. The Citizins concept came from the point that Africans would do anything for American citizenship. At first I was only making shirts for a group of friends for parties and it just started catching on and people where coming to me for orders.
